Summary 0008521: Overprint setting is lost when copying page
Description When a page is copied using "Copy" from the "Page" menu, the overprinting setting of all objects on the new page is "Knockout", regardless of their settings on the original page.
Steps To Reproduce Create a new document. Create a box on the first page and set it from "Knockout" to "Overprint". Copy the page. The box on the newly created page has the setting back to "Knockout".
Additional Information When looking into this, I noticed that the CopyPasteBuffer struct doesn't even have a doOverprint member.
